The Cleveland Browns entered the mix of teams interested in signing free-agent offensive lineman L.J. Shelton. With veteran left tackle Ross Verba threatening to sit out the season, Shelton potentially could step into a starting position.

 

Wherever he goes, it's likely to be for only a one-year deal. If he played an entire season at left tackle, his value would be higher on the market next year than if he played guard, where the Bears want him.

 

Shelton already has visited Houston. Jacksonville and Kansas City also are interested in the former first-round pick of the Cardinals.
